New Balance Athletic Shoes | Model Number and Style Number

As one of the premier shoe brands, New Balance is constantly evolving its technology to better suit the needs of consumers. To track those innovations and allow you to accurately choose the style of shoe that best fits your needs, New Balance uses a 3 part system to create the full style number for each shoe. The full style number can be found under the tongue of the shoe and is unique to each gender, model, and color.

Model Number and Style Number

In general, higher numbers have more technology built into them. This isn’t always the case but holds true more often than not.

The full style number is broken down into the following 3 parts and can be found on the underside of the tongue.

Part 1

The Letter before the number indicates the gender and the activity the shoe was designed for…

MT = Men’s Trail
WT = Women’s Trail
MW = Men’s Walking
WW = Women’s Walking
MX = Men’s Cross-Training
WX = Women’s Cross-Training
MC/MCH/MCY = Men’s Tennis
WC/WCH/WCY = Women’s Tennis

US = Made in The USA

UK = Made in The United Kingdom

Kids shoes have a different letter system

G = grade school
P = preschool
I = infant
Y = youth (preschool and grade school)

Part 2

The numbers are the model number. The last 2 digits of the model number indicate the technology in that particular shoe.

40 = Optimal Control *

  • Best for over-pronators and low arches
  • Superior control, stability, cushioning, and support
  • Supports proper foot biomechanics
  • *With the exception of the 840v4 running & 840v2 walking. These styles are neutral cushion styles.

50 = Fitness Running

  • Best for indoor workouts or training on roads
  • Visually appealing
  • Innovative technology
  • Maximum responsiveness and power for athletes

60 = Stability

  • Pronation reduction
  • Maximum stability control
  • Maximum cushioning and comfort

70 = Light Stability

  • Perfect combination of stability and speed
  • Lighter, sleek profile
  • Designed for runners who train at a faster pace

80 = Neutral

  • Designed for high-mileage runners
  • Light-weight
  • Superior cushioning

90 = Speed *

  • Designed for speed and distance runners
  • Superior ride and fit
  • Professional runners’ choice
  • *With the exception of the 990v5 and its predecessors. 

Part 3

Any letters after the number typically indicate the color of the shoe.

WB = White and Blue

BK = Black

GL = Grey

Version

Any letter or number following the color designation is the version number.

v5 = Version 5

v6 = Version 6

There are some versions of New Balance shoes that don’t seem to fit the model number or style number because the number on the side of the shoe or in the sales description may not be the full model or style number listed under the tongue of the actual shoe.
